For three days, I have had a sore throat, body pains, weakness, headache, runny nose, and burning eyes. I do not think it is COVID-19, as I was infected only three months back, and it took one month for me to completely recover. I am double vaccinated for COVID-19. I do not use masks when I am in public. Can it be a COVID-19 infection again? Kindly suggest some medicines for my symptoms.

I understand your concern and would be happy to help. Yes, Covid can reinfect. However, as you are vaccinated, the severity will be mild. So, there is no need to panic. I suggest you follow the below treatment plan. Consult with a specialist doctor, talk to him or her, and take medicines with their consent.
I also suggest you do warm water gargling and steam inhalation four to five times a day.
